Origin

Gemellus takes its name from the Latin gemelli, meaning "twin brothers" – a fitting name for a restaurant born from the collaboration of twin siblings Maxime and Clément Le Meur. Maxime is the chef; Clément, the entrepreneur. Their restaurant sits on the left bank, at 37 avenue Duquesne in the 7th arrondissement of Paris, at the crossroads of the Invalides and UNESCO. The concept: a relaxed French gastronomy served in a warm, elegant setting.

Chef Maxime Le Meur

Originally from Brittany and trained in Grenoble, Maxime Le Meur honed his skills in Paris. He spent more than five years in the kitchens of Apicius under chef Jean‑Pierre Vigato, then worked at the Georges V and later at l’Affable in the same neighbourhood. After that, he rejoined Vigato for the reopening of the legendary Lapérouse. Today, Le Meur brings his own culinary vision to life at Gemellus – his own decor, his own colours, his own cuisine.

The Nuancier – Menus of Nuance

The menu, called Le Nuancier (the colour chart), evolves with the seasons. The phrase “les nuances” is woven into everything here: nuances of flavours, textures, colours. Guests choose between two degustation paths – the 5 Shades menu (80€) or the 7 Shades menu (100€) – or a lunch formula. A wine pairing option, curated by director Laurent, adds another layer of nuance (50€ or 70€). The cooking is modern cuisine, marked by original “terre‑mer” (land‑sea) combinations and sauces that are both subtle and powerful, elevating each dish without overwhelming it.

Atmosphere and Recognition

The dining room is designed as a “véritable écrin gastronomique” – a genuine gastronomic jewel box – with a décor that is both comfortable and sophisticated. This refined approach has earned Gemellus a spot in the Michelin guide for 2026, listed as Recommended. It is a place where the brothers’ shared vision and Maxime’s precise cooking create a distinct, personal experience in the heart of Paris.
